Company secures 4th position in JMK Research report for Q4 2025.
Ballestra brings a portfolio of internationally recognized technology licenses.
Subscribe to our Newsletter & Stay updated
Reach out to us
Call us at +91 8108603000 or
Schedule a Call Back
Call us now at +91 8108603000